Transaction 3a8e277d5c1c27919c04c2559235f8ac8204b2b29f2320520807574df6788523
1 Input
1 Output
-
3a8e277d5c1c27919c04c2559235f8ac8204b2b29f2320520807574df6788523:0
- value
- 322692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d21f1d36ca7bbe1913e268ee5cda1a3da8b593a OP_EQUAL
- address
- 3QmTYbFDzPwKJnGEiSqTpYGGjMtTsghEex